Brigantine New Jersey has a year-round population just above 9,000 people – that may not be tiny, but it’s small enough to create a real sense of local community on the island. Even during the summer when the population more than triples for several months, the island is not nearly as touristy as other cities on the Jersey shore.

BUILDING / UNIT INTERIORS:
This property was originally constructed in 1927. According to local lore the Inn was frequented by Al Jolson and Al Capone and various other mob bosses and figures that preferred this location over Atlantic City.
Over the years ownership was transferred to various entities, and today the Brigantine Inn is run by Legacy Vacation Club Resorts, who have tried to retain the essence and some of the design elements found in the original construction.
